About the role

Key responsibilities & impact
  • managing moderately complex litigation arising out of the auto or property contract in compliance with state laws and regulations
  • creating strategy for defense or settlement
  • evaluating, negotiating, and collaborating with defense counsel to secure appropriate resolution
  • delivering a concierge level of best-in-class member service through setting appropriate expectations, proactive communications, advice and empathy
  • managing serious injury or property damage, questionable damages, questionable liability and questionable coverage issues
  • applying intermediate knowledge of claims litigation processes
  • proactively managing litigation and acting as liaison with members, internal and external counsel
  • clearly documenting litigation strategy, litigation budget, investigation, evaluation, negotiation, settlement, and trial decisions
  • representing USAA at mediations, case conferences, and/or trials
  • reviewing, auditing, and approving legal fees and expenses
  • partnering and/or directing law firm vendors to facilitate timely lawsuit resolution
  • recognizing and solving routine and intermediate issues arising out of legal case management
  • following practices and processes to achieve results to positively impact the quality, timeliness and effectiveness of the team; proactively identifying opportunities to improve processes
  • interacting with membership, attorneys and management to advise on moderately complex litigation
  • ensuring members receive high levels of service from themselves and law firm vendors
  • ensuring risks associated with business activities are effectively identified, measured, monitored, and controlled in accordance with risk and compliance policies and procedures

Requirements

What you’ll need
  • Bachelor's degree; OR 4 years of related experience may be substituted in lieu of degree
  • 4 years work experience handling liability and first party claims or progressive experience in litigation
  • 2 years customer contact experience
  • Claims adjusters license in assigned state or ability to obtain license within 3 months
  • Demonstrated negotiation and customer service skills
  • Excellent communication skills with experience as an effective liaison between partners, members, outside counsel and management
  • Knowledge of P&C policies state laws
  • Knowledge of regulatory compliance related to claims and claims litigation
  • Experience handling large losses auto, property or commercial
  • Knowledge of Microsoft Office tools to include Word, Excel, and PowerPoint
